Head coach of the Black Galaxies, Kassim Ocansey Mingle has announced a 20-man list for the high profile pre-AFCON friendly game against South Africa on December 16.
The South African Football Association (SAFA) has confirmed that Bafana Bafana will wrap up their preparations for the 2026 AFCON with a final game against the home-based national team of Ghana in South Africa.
Ghana failed to secure a qualification to the Africa Cup of Nations after a disastrous campaign during the qualifiers where they finished at the bottom of Group F with teams like Sudan, Angola, and Niger.
The Black Stars are now focusing on the 2027 Africa Cup of Nations qualifiers scheduled to commence in March 2026 and the 2026 FIFA World Cup for which Ghana has been drawn in Group L alongside England, Croatia, and Panama.
Coach Mingle’s squad had only one player from Hearts of Oak and none from their rivals Asante Kotoko. Medeama SC had the most names with five while Nations FC had three.
South Africa are in Group B in the AFCON, and they will face Egypt, Angola, and Zimbabwe
The Bafana Bafana will play their first match of the continental tournament against Angola on 22 December 2025.
